1. Specifications Breakdown
| Feature | Google Pixel 7 Pro | Xiaomi Poco M6 4G | Real-World Implications |
|---|---|---|---|
| Design | |||
| Dimensions (mm) | 162.9 x 76.6 x 8.9 | 168.6 x 76.3 x 8.3 | Pixel 7 Pro is slightly more compact. Poco M6 4G is thinner. |
| Weight (g) | 212 | 205 | Negligible difference in weight; both feel substantial in hand. |
| Build Materials | Aluminum frame, Gorilla Glass Victus | Plastic frame, Gorilla Glass 3 | Pixel feels more premium and offers better durability. Poco M6 4G prioritizes affordability. |
| Display | |||
| Display Type | LTPO AMOLED | IPS LCD | Pixel delivers vibrant colors, deeper blacks, and power efficiency due to LTPO. Poco M6 4G is basic but functional. |
| Size (inches) | 6.7 | 6.79 | Nearly identical screen real estate. |
| Resolution | 1440 x 3120 | 1080 x 2460 | Pixel boasts significantly sharper visuals (512 ppi vs. 396 ppi). |
| Refresh Rate | 120Hz | 90Hz | Pixel offers smoother scrolling and animations. |
| Performance | |||
| Chipset | Google Tensor G2 | Mediatek Helio G91 | Tensor G2 offers superior AI processing and overall performance. Helio G91 targets efficiency. |
| CPU | Octa-core (2x2.85 GHz Cortex-X1...) | Octa-core (2x2.0 GHz Cortex-A75...) | Pixel's CPU has higher clock speeds and more powerful cores, resulting in much faster performance. |
| RAM | 12GB | 8GB | Pixel's larger RAM enables better multitasking and smoother performance with demanding apps. |
| Camera | |||
| Main Camera | 50MP | 108MP | Pixel emphasizes image processing over raw megapixels, generally producing better real-world results. |
| Telephoto | 48MP (5x optical) | None | Clear advantage for Pixel with its dedicated telephoto lens for zoomed shots. |
| Ultrawide | 12MP | None | Another win for Pixel; ultrawide lens provides creative framing options. |
| Battery | |||
| Capacity (mAh) | 5000 | 5030 | Negligible difference in battery capacity. Real-world battery life will depend on usage patterns. |
| Price | Medium | Low | Pixel 7 Pro commands a higher price reflecting its premium features and performance. |
2. Key Insights
The Pixel 7 Pro excels in display quality, performance, camera versatility, and software experience. Its Tensor G2 chip delivers AI-powered features and blazing-fast performance. The camera system, while not boasting the highest megapixel count, consistently produces stunning images thanks to Google's computational photography prowess.
The Poco M6 4G, on the other hand, prioritizes affordability. While its performance is adequate for everyday tasks, it lags behind the Pixel significantly. The camera system, while featuring a high-resolution main sensor, lacks the versatility and advanced features of the Pixel.

4. Buying Decision Framework
- What is your budget? If price is a major constraint, the Poco M6 4G offers decent value. However, if you can stretch your budget, the Pixel 7 Pro is a significantly better phone overall.
- What are your primary smartphone needs? For demanding tasks like gaming, photography, and video editing, the Pixel is the clear winner. For basic communication and web browsing, the Poco M6 4G is sufficient.
- How important is software and long-term support? Pixel phones receive timely Android updates and security patches directly from Google, ensuring a smooth and secure experience for years to come. The Poco M6 4G's update schedule is less certain.
